在VSCode中如何配置Python环境,包括安装Python解析器、插件、第三方库,以及配置launch.json和settings.json文件,来提升Python开发和调试效率?
时间: 2024-11-08 19:21:44 浏览: 33
为了帮助你高效配置VSCode中的Python开发环境,建议阅读《VSCode Python环境配置详指南:从基础到高级设置》。这本书详细介绍了如何一步步搭建完整的Python开发环境,涵盖了从基础设置到高级自定义的每一个环节。
参考资源链接:[VSCode Python环境配置详指南:从基础到高级设置](https://wenku.csdn.net/doc/6k5nztsg8u?spm=1055.2569.3001.10343)
首先,确保你已经安装了合适的Python解释器。在VSCode中,通过快捷键`Ctrl+Shift+P`(或`Cmd+Shift+P`在macOS上),输入并选择`Python: Select Interpreter`命令,以选择一个已安装的Python解释器。在选择过程中,VSCode会自动列出所有可用的Python环境。
接下来,安装VSCode所需的核心插件。打开扩展面板,搜索并安装官方的Python插件,它提供代码补全、调试支持等。此外,安装flake8进行代码质量检查,以及yapf进行代码格式化。可以通过VSCode内部的终端使用pip安装这些包:
```bash
pip install flake8 yapf
```
在`settings.json`文件中,可以设置代码格式化工具偏好和调试配置等。例如,指定使用yapf作为默认的代码格式化工具:
```json
{
参考资源链接:[VSCode Python环境配置详指南:从基础到高级设置](https://wenku.csdn.net/doc/6k5nztsg8u?spm=1055.2569.3001.10343)
阅读全文